If Johnny is the optimist, Frankie is the realist. Pfeiffer delivers a career-defining performance as a waitress who has been bruised by life. She is guarded, cynical, and terrified of being hurt again. Her resistance to Johnny’s advances is not a plot device but a deeply ingrained defense mechanism.
